Block 1657594

81d2ef7a38ea934c65df4fcda55c88cf82dfcfd187e358095aacaace5ed5a0a8
Transactions1
Height1657594
Confirmations3710103
TimestampMon, 03 Apr 2017 01:43:12 UTC
Size (bytes)212
Version2
Merkle Root54a87060e4e43b805759bf98f7209612ae1fec3059d62d3a32b6ed5c797f6abb
Nonce3366769667
Bits1c219203
Difficulty7.625658673122228

Transactions

No Inputs (Newly Generated Coins)
Fee: 0 FTC
3710103 Confirmations80 FTC